ORGANIZATION SUMMARY

World Relief is a global Christian humanitarian organization whose mission is to boldly engage the world’s greatest crises in partnership with the church. The organization was founded in the aftermath of World War II to respond to the urgent humanitarian needs of war-torn Europe. Since then, for 80 years, across 100 countries, World Relief has partnered with local churches and communities to build a world where families thrive and communities flourish.

Today, organizational programming focuses on humanitarian and disaster response, community strengthening and resilience, and refugee & immigrant services and advocacy.

POSITION SUMMARY:

World Relief seeks an Employment Program Specialist to provide critical services and counsel to refugees and other eligible persons as they search for initial employment or seek career advancement and job upgrade opportunities. This position assists refugees and other eligible persons to become economically self-sufficient by preparing them for employment, utilizing employer contacts to place them in jobs, counseling on job upgrades and career pathway opportunities, and maintaining and expanding an employer network. This role is based out of the Austin office.

This is a limited-term position funded through a grant agreement until September 30, 2026, and contingent upon funding extension.

ROLE &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Make connections with new employers to advocate for the hiring of clients in their companies
  • Researching new job opportunities outside of the normal entry level jobs available to clients
  • Researching vocational trainings and guiding clients in career paths aimed at accomplishing clients’ career goals
  • Learn best practices for finding and securing employment for clients by attending employment trainings
  • Maintain regular communication with clients through client home visits, phone calls and office visits
  • Monitor files to ensure all required documents are included and files are in compliance with RSS Employment Guidelines
  • Enter employment information in the ClientTrack database weekly
  • Maintain detailed and accurate case notes for all client interactions
  • Assist clients in developing letters of recommendation, resumes, and applications
  • Attend scheduled meetings and maintain regular office hours
  • Provide transportation to interviews, orientations, and employment for clients for the first few days as needed
  • Assist clients with employment forms, drug screening tests, and securing state documentation
  • Maintain open lines of communication with current employers reporting issues back to Program Manager as needed to foster relationships with employers notifying Program Manager of potential new employers
  • Equip clients to conduct independent employment searches
  • Assist clients with job retention and upward mobility of employment, as needed
  • Refer clients to other programs and services as needed
  • Maintain an initial employment orientation session with each client for the purpose of preparing refugees for employment and update as needed
